Back child support cannot be canceled in a bankruptcy proceeding. Once it is owed, it will always be owed, until paid. You cannot use bankruptcy to get out of having to pay your child support obligation.

When someone is killed and it was the fault of another person or company Texas law allows certain family members to file suit for wrongful death. These family members include the decedent's spouse, children, and parents. No one else may bring a claim. Grandparents, siblings, foster parents, and other relatives are not entitled to bring a wrongful death claim, no matter how close they were to the decedent or financially dependent upon him they were. Stepchildren and stepparents of the decedent may not bring a wrongful death claim unless there had been an adoption. The wrongful death claimants may sue for their mental anguish, pecuniary loss (such as loss of care, maintenance, support, services, advice, counsel and monetary contributions they would have received from the decedent if he or she had lived), loss of companionship and society, and loss of inheritance. When suits are brought against non-subscribers, courts have historically submitted a negligence issue against the employer, as well as any additional instructions to assist the jury in determining the employer's negligence. The most common defendant's submission has been the "sole cause" instruction, employers rely on to argue that the employee's sole negligence, or the sole negligence of a third-party, is the only reason for the accident or occurrence in question. However, the issue of the employee's negligence, historically, has not been submitted to the jury. Law Solicitors Mercer County WV When a nurse makes a mistake, that could result in the patient not getting the right treatment, getting delayed treatment, or getting misdiagnosed. If the patient's medical condition isn't properly treated because of the error, the patient may experience worsening symptoms that cause pain or serious illness. In some cases, nursing errors could be fatal.
